Output 0639f07782613950f9e86c73dc7c3ac31ffaa51c5b5d94a243766b5a83982d1e:21

value
401027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c907e2cd3de21c61fd8ce513130ad25ed76d0b OP_EQUAL
address
33DmZUgwpJwZxyJF4qk6HNKGbCYPr4gKva
transaction
0639f07782613950f9e86c73dc7c3ac31ffaa51c5b5d94a243766b5a83982d1e
spent
true